Trick Concepts of Building Bookkeeping



Understanding the distinct financial landscape of the building and construction sector needs a firm understanding of essential principles of building and construction accountancy. Construction Accounting. At its core, building and construction accountancy differs considerably from standard audit methods due to the intricacies intrinsic in project-based operations. One basic principle is job setting you back, which entails tracking all expenditures connected to individual jobs. This enables specialists to evaluate earnings accurately and take care of budgets properly.


An additional essential concept is the usage of development billing, which allows contractors to get repayments based upon the portion of job finished. This technique assists preserve cash money circulation throughout the task period, crucial for functional security. In addition, understanding revenue recognition is important; the percentage-of-completion approach is often used to line up profits with task landmarks, reflecting the project's financial reality.


Furthermore, building accountancy highlights the relevance of accurate forecasting and budgeting, as jobs often extend over a number of months or years. Efficient task monitoring tools and software can aid in keeping an eye on financial performance, guaranteeing that all stakeholders have exposure right into the job's economic wellness. Understanding these concepts equips building companies to navigate their special monetary difficulties and enhance their functional performance.


Obstacles Distinct to Building Jobs



What difficulties do building and construction tasks encounter that established them besides various other sectors? One significant challenge is the intrinsic intricacy of construction projects, which frequently involve multiple stakeholders, consisting of service providers, clients, subcontractors, and distributors. Each event may have different top priorities and timelines, leading to control troubles that can impact job distribution.


Furthermore, construction jobs are susceptible to changes in product costs and labor accessibility, which can disrupt schedules and budgets. Climate condition likewise posture a special challenge, as unexpected hold-ups can cause increased costs and extended timelines. Additionally, governing conformity and allowing procedures differ by area, including another layer of complexity that must be navigated thoroughly.


Another distinct hurdle is the project lifecycle, defined by phases such as design, bargain, purchase, and building. Each stage needs careful planning and financial tracking to ensure source appropriation straightens with task objectives. The capacity for modification orders and scope alterations further makes complex monetary management, necessitating durable audit techniques to preserve profitability.


Last but not least, the market often grapples with capital issues, as settlements are often contingent upon project landmarks. This can strain financial sources, making efficient construction audit important to getting rid of these challenges.

Crucial Devices and Software Program



How can building and construction business efficiently handle their economic data in an increasingly intricate landscape? Building bookkeeping software supplies robust solutions for tracking costs, managing spending plans, and producing monetary records.


Popular construction accountancy tools, such as Sage 300 Construction and Realty, Point Of View View, and copyright Specialist, offer functions that facilitate project-based accountancy. These systems enable real-time tracking of work costs, pay-roll handling, and invoicing, enabling better financial exposure and control. In addition, cloud-based services give the advantage of remote gain access to, making certain that stakeholders can collaborate properly regardless of their place.


Incorporating project administration software program with accounting tools additionally boosts operational effectiveness. This combination permits smooth data sharing, decreasing the chance of errors and enhancing decision-making. Eventually, picking the appropriate combination of vital devices and software program is vital for construction business aiming to enhance their monetary monitoring and maintain development in an open market.
